ABOUT AUGUSTA TECHNICAL COLLEGE

Augusta Technical College,
a unit of the Technical College System of Georgia, is a two-year college located in Augusta,
Georgia. Since its opening in 1961, Augusta
Technical College has remained dedicated to promoting educational, economic, and community development in its service area (Burke, Columbia,
Lincoln, McDuffie, and Richmond
Counties). The college offers over 100 academic programs in high-demand areas such as Allied Health
Sciences &
Nursing, Business, Public & Professional Services, Cyber, Digital, and Engineering Technologies, accredited by the

Southern Association of Colleges and Schools Commission on Colleges (SACSCOC). The college also offers adult education/GED, ESL, and
continuing education programs through the Division of Economic Development.



ABOUT AUGUSTA, GEORGIA

Augusta,
GA, is a regional center for medicine, biotechnology, and cybersecurity. Located near the Georgia/South
Carolina border (Central
Savannah River Area), the area holds many accolades: Most Neighborly City in America, Best
Cities to Start a Business, and a Top Ten
Places in the South to Hire Vets. The area is internationally known for the
PGA’s Masters Tournament held at the Augusta National Golf
Club and being the home of James Brown; while also bolstering the Augusta Riverwalk, Savannah Rapids Pavilion, Evans Towne Center Park, and
home of the US Army
Cyber Center of Excellence at Fort Gordon.
